ls

inlinetoc

[abcdefgiklmnpqrstuxABCFGLNQRSUX178]

  • 기 능 DOS의 'dir'과 유사한 명령으로 파일명, 디렉토리명 등을 출력시키며 옵션에 따라 다양한 정보와 함께 출력된다.
  • 문 법 ls <file1> <file2> …<fileN>

<file1>부터 <fileN>까지의 파일명이나 디렉토리명을 출력시킨다.

옵 션

-a  디렉토리 내의 모든 파일 출력한다.
-i  파일의 inode와 함께 출력한다.
-l  파일 허용 여부, 소유자, 그룹, 크기, 날짜 등을 출력한다.
-m  파일을 쉼표로 구분하여 가로로 출력한다.
-r  정렬 옵션이 선택되었을 때, 그 역순으로 출력한다.
-s  KB 단위의 파일 크기를 출력한다.
-t  최근에 생성된 파일순으로 출력한다.
-x  파일 순서를 세로로 출력한다.
-F  파일의 형태와 함께 출력한다.
출력되는 파일의 형태는 ‘*’, ‘@’, ‘|’, ‘=’ 등이며, 이것은 각각 실행 파일, 심볼릭 링크, FIFO 소켓을 나타낸다.
-R  서브 디렉토리의 내용을 포함하여 출력한다.
-S  파일 크기가 큰 순서로 출력한다.
-U  정렬하여 출력한다.
-1  라인당 한 파일씩 출력한다.
--help  도움말을 출력한다.
--version ‘ls’의 파일 버전과 함께 출력한다.

사용예

/home/mine 디렉토리 내용을 파일 허용 여부, 소유자, 그룹등의 정보와 파일의 형태를 포함하여 출력

  ls -lF /home/mine

이 명령은 DOS에서의 ‘dir’ 명령에 의한 출력과 유사하다.

길게 숨김파일을 포함하여 나열함

ls -la

목록을 자세히 그리고 숨김파일을 포함하여 파일사이즈순으로 용량을 알아보기 쉽게

ls -lahS